About the role
- Responsible for driving lead generation and engagement with healthcare practitioners (HCPs) such as nutritionists, physicians, clinics, and wellness centers
- Identify, nurture, and qualify prospects to expand Niagen Bioscience product reach in clinical and wellness channels
- Deliver targeted outbound outreach, assist with educational campaigns, and schedule product demos and meetings for the sales team
- Operate cross-functionally with Business Development, Marketing, and Medical Affairs teams to contribute to revenue growth and practitioner onboarding
- Research and identify healthcare professionals, wellness clinics, functional medicine practices, and IV therapy centers within assigned territories
- Execute multi-channel outreach campaigns including cold calling, email sequences, LinkedIn outreach, and conference networking
- Qualify inbound leads from medical conferences, webinars, and healthcare-focused marketing campaigns
- Maintain a pipeline of 100+ active healthcare prospects with regular touchpoints and follow-up activities
- Conduct initial educational conversations about NAD+ science, clinical research, and product applications
- Schedule and facilitate product demonstration calls with healthcare providers and their staff
- Coordinate sample requests and clinical literature distribution to qualified prospects
- Support webinar attendance and continuing education initiatives for healthcare professionals
- Develop trusted relationships with medical office managers, practice administrators, and healthcare decision-makers
- Maintain detailed prospect profiles and track all interactions in Salesforce CRM with 95%+ accuracy
- Provide market intelligence on competitor activities, pricing trends, and healthcare industry developments
Requirements
- 2-3 years of experience in sales, account management, or B2B prospecting preferably within healthcare verticals
- Strong understanding of consumer product operations, strategic decision-making, and unit economic analysis
- Experience with CRM platforms (Salesforce preferred), sales engagement tools, and healthcare databases
- Knowledge of dietary supplements, functional medicine, or anti-aging/longevity sectors preferred
- Excellent phone presence and ability to engage healthcare professionals in meaningful conversations
- Bachelor's degree in life sciences, healthcare administration, business, or related field preferred
- Proven track record of meeting or exceeding lead generation and qualification targets
- Scientific curiosity and ability to understand and communicate complex research concepts
- Professional demeanor suitable for healthcare environment interactions
- Strong organizational skills with ability to manage multiple prospect cycles simultaneously
- Resilience and persistence in prospecting activities with high rejection rates
- Collaborative approach to working with account management and medical affairs teams
